Kindergarten sign-ups set
Kindergarten registration for Shepherdstown Elementary School will take place on Thursday, Mar. 22. Students will be divided according to their last name. Times are as follows: 9-10:30 a.m. for those with last names beginning with A-F; 10:30 a.m.-12 p.m. for those with last names beginning with G-L; 1-2 p.m. for students with last names beginning with M-R; and 2-3 p.m. for students with last names beginning with S-Z.
Speech, language and hearing screenings will be conduced at the time of registration.
A state certified birth certificate is required by State Law. Registering families are also required to bring a proof of residency and a social security card to registration.
A health screening is also required. Forms are available at local physician offices and the Jefferson County Board of Education office. Certain immunizations are required before a child can register. These include: four doses of DPT, with one dose after the fourth birthday; three doses of polio vaccine with one dose after the fourth birthday; two doses of MMR (measles, mumps and rubella) vaccine with the first dose after the first birthday; two doses of Varicella (chickenpox) with first dose after the first birthday; three doses of Hepatitis B vaccine with the last dose after the age of six months; and a tuberculin test for out of state transfer students only which must be given within 30 days of entering school.
A child must be five years old before Sept. 1 to enter kindergarten. School policy allows admission of children born between Sept. 1 and Sept. 15 inclusive only if they meet eligibility requirements.
